The applicability of the uvby,beta photometric system to the classification and study of B-type supergiants (BTS) is investigated using published data on 157 BTS and observations of 17 BTS made with the 36-in. reflector at McDonald Observatory. The results are presented in tabular form and analyzed to produce preliminary calibrations of luminosity class vs. beta index and of absolute magnitude (Mv) vs. beta (or delta Mv vs. delta beta) for four associations of stars. The effectiveness of various color indices as temperature indicators is discussed. It is shown that there is good correspondence between MK and uvby,beta classifications of B-type main-sequence stars, giants, and BTS, confirming the usefulness of the uvby,beta system in further research on BTS.
